Neotropical otter vs olive baboon
Lontra longicaudis compared with Papio anubis
Key Differences
- Neotropical otter is Data Deficient while olive baboon is Least Concern.
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Neotropical otter | olive baboon |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Carnivora (Carnivorans) | Primates (Primates) |
| Family | Mustelidae (Weasels & Otters) |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) |
| Genus | Lontra | Papio |
| Species | Lontra longicaudis | Papio anubis |
Evolutionary Relationship
Neotropical otter and olive baboon share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
